Special envoys of South Korean President call on EAM Jaishankar in New Delhi

New Delhi, July 17 (SocialNews.XYZ) External Affairs Minister (EAM) S. Jaishankar on Thursday met a delegation of Special Envoys of South Korean President Lee Jae Myung which was led by Kim Boo-kyum, former Prime Minister of South Korea. During the meeting, both sides discussed ways to deepen cooperation in the areas of economy, technology, defence, and maritime security, along with enhancing people-to-people exchanges. Syro-Malabar Church in jubilation as priest will be elevated to Cardinal

Kottayam (Kerala) | The priests, nuns and laity of the Kerala-based Syro-Malabar Church are jubilant as their priest, George Jacob Koovakad, will be elevated to the rank of Cardinal by Pope Francis at St Peter's Basilica, on December 7, at 9 PM. Koovakad, 51, from Kerala, who has been organising Pope Francis' international travels since 2020, will be among the 21 clergy elevated to the rank of Cardinal.
